Brief Explanations
- For the first question, the cell membrane is selectively permeable and controls transport. The cell wall provides structural support, mitochondria are for energy - production, and the Golgi apparatus is involved in modifying, sorting, and packaging proteins.
- For the second question, in a hypotonic solution, water enters the erythrocyte (red blood cell) causing it to burst, which is called hemolysis. Crenation occurs in a hypertonic solution, plasmolysis in plant cells in a hypertonic environment, and turgor is related to plant cell pressure.
- For the third question, the circular field seen through a microscope is the field of view. Magnification is about how much an object is enlarged, illumination is about the light source, and working distance is the distance between the objective lens and the specimen.
